A Manual for Manuel

Author Name    Cortazar, Julio

Title   A Manual for Manuel

Binding   Hard Cover

Book Condition   Fine

Jacket Condition   Near Fine

Edition   First American

Publisher   New York Pantheon Books 1978

ISBN Number    0-394-49661-2 / 9780394496610

Seller ID   000196

Fine copy of stated first American edition in near fine mylared dust jacket. Dust jacket has a small chip to upper back cover near spine, a little rubbing to the tips and some sunning to top and bottom edges. Black cloth boards with gold lettering to spine and cover. Translated from the Spanish by Gregory Rabassa. 391 pp. With this book Cortazar jumps into politics. We specialize in Latin American literature in translation.
